โœฆ Synopsis


This paper describes an algorithm for parallel assembling of the stiness matrix in structural analysis in shared memory environments. In this algorithm the stiness matrix is assembled by groups of lines related to each node of the ยฎnite element mesh. Therefore as each processor will only assemble the lines related to a speciยฎc group of nodes, no synchronization is required to avoid that two or more processor try to update the same part of the memory concurrently and the task can be equally distributed among processors. Some examples are presented and they show that the proposed algorithm has a very good speed up rate and eciency.
